Location and Accessibility

Viera Wetlands boasts a prime location at 10001 N Wickham Rd in Melbourne, Florida, ensuring effortless access for locals and travelers alike. Its full address simplifies navigation, while its central position within the city makes it a favored destination for nature lovers. Nestled near the crossroads of North Wickham Road and Viera Boulevard, the wetlands enjoy convenient access from major thoroughfares such as Interstate 95 and State Road 404.

Experiences and Attractions

Viera Wetlands offers a plethora of outdoor activities and attractions designed to engage visitors of all ages. Here are some highlights:

  • Birdwatching: The wetlands are a birdwatcher’s paradise, boasting a rich diversity of avian species. Grab your binoculars and marvel at the sight of graceful herons, colorful ducks, and majestic eagles as they soar overhead or wade in the tranquil waters.
  • Photography: Capture the beauty of nature through the lens of your camera as you wander along scenic pathways and observation points. From vibrant sunsets to close-up shots of wildlife, there’s no shortage of breathtaking scenes waiting to be immortalized.
  • Nature Trails: Explore the wetlands’ network of walking paths and boardwalks, offering unparalleled views of lush marshes, serene ponds, and vibrant foliage. Take a leisurely stroll or embark on a guided nature walk to discover hidden gems and encounter native wildlife up close.
  • Wildlife Viewing: Keep your eyes peeled for resident wildlife species, including alligators, turtles, otters, and more, as they go about their daily activities in their natural habitat. Exercise caution and maintain a respectful distance to ensure the safety of both visitors and wildlife.

Visitor Guidelines

Visitors to Viera Wetlands are encouraged to follow guidelines to minimize impact on the environment and ensure an enjoyable experience for all:

  • Stick to designated trails and observation points to avoid disturbing sensitive habitats.
  • Respect wildlife by observing from a safe distance and refraining from feeding or approaching animals.
  • Dispose of trash responsibly and leave no trace behind to help preserve the natural beauty of the wetlands.
  • Observe all posted rules and regulations, including any restrictions on pets or recreational activities.
